Property Description
What can be more San Franciscan than a majestic Victorian home, with an inviting garden, on a beautiful tree-lined street, in the immediate vicinity of many of the vibrant cafes and restaurants that define our extraordinary City? 249 Fair Oaks is a fully detached 19th century architectural masterpiece that has been lovingly restored and remodeled to the delight of its 21st century stewards. The graceful Victorian home is a celebration of aesthetic pleasure that carefully balances the charm and refinement of what is old, with the utility and functionality of what is new. To live in this home is to be constantly reminded of the joy that craftsmanship, art, and beauty offer us; contributing mightily to our inner peace, power, and pleasure. With 3 bedrooms and 2.5 bathrooms, voluminous public rooms, all on an irregular 32' x 117' lot, the home abounds in unique features and amenities. The Victorian era bay windows, grand staircase, quiet veranda, ornate fireplaces, endless architectural detail, and intricately adorned dining room chandelier, blend seamlessly with the modern chef's kitchen, featuring a BlueStar Range and wall oven, Sub-Zero refrigerator, marble counters, center island, breakfast room, and more. The gated side driveway leads to a full garage / basement that will delight "motor heads", cyclists, and all those with lots of life's "good stuff" who dream of having the storage space to keep, collect, and display it! Mature shade trees grace the whimsical east garden, adding to the privacy, serenity, and allure of this San Francisco oasis. The stoutly built rear staircase leads all the way up from the garden level to the roof level, from which views of the downtown skyline and Bay Bridge serve as a constant reminder that 1849 marked but one of the many Gold Rushes that have brought artists, visionaries, disruptors, and entrepreneurs to the shores of our beloved City, generation after generation.
